Thomas Watkins

Thomas Watkins

Stress Engineer (Fans) @ Rolls-Royce

About Thomas Watkins

Thomas Watkins is a Stress Engineer specializing in fans at Rolls-Royce, where he has worked since 2012 in Bristol, United Kingdom. He holds a Bachelor of Science degree in Mechanical Engineering from Cardiff University, which he completed in 2011.

People similar to Thomas Watkins